Official title
A Phase 3 Randomized Controlled Trial of Rondecabtagene Autoleucel , an Autologous, Dual-targeting CD19/CD20 CAR T-Cell Product Candidate, Vs. Investigator's Choice of CD19 CAR T-Cell Therapy in Patients With Relapsed or Refractory Large B-Cell Lymphoma in the Second-line Setting
About this study
PiNACLE-H2H is a Phase 3 randomized controlled trial comparing the efficacy and safety of rondecabtagene autoleucel (ronde-cel, formerly known as LYL314) against the currently approved cluster of differentiation (CD)19 chimeric antigen receptor (CAR) T-cell therapies (axicabtagene ciloleucel \[axi-cel\] or lisocabtagene maraleucel \[liso-cel\]), in patients with aggressive LBCL that has relapsed or is refractory to first-line anti-CD20 antibody and anthracycline-containing chemotherapy. Patients will be randomized (1:1) before leukapheresis to receive either: * Ronde-cel; or * Investigator's choice of axi-cel or liso-cel Most patients who receive currently approved CD19-directed CAR T-cell therapies, including axi-cel and liso-cel, still experience progressive disease, often due to mechanisms such as CD19 antigen loss or T-cell exhaustion. Ronde-cel is a novel, autologous, dual-targeting CD19/CD20 CAR T-cell product candidate enriched for CD62L-positive naïve and central memory T cells, which are associated with enhanced proliferation capacity and persistence. Ronde-cel is an "OR"-gated CAR construct that can fully activate upon recognition of either CD19 or CD20, aiming to improve durability of response despite antigen heterogeneity. Approximately 400 participants will be enrolled. CAR T-cell therapy in both arms will be administered as a single intravenous infusion following fludarabine and cyclophosphamide lymphodepletion. Participants will be followed for 3 years for safety and efficacy, with long-term follow-up extending to 15 years.
Eligibility criteria
Key Inclusion Criteria: 1. CAR T cell naïve and eligible to receive a CD19 CART-cell therapy 2. Histologically confirmed large B-cell lymphoma, including the following types defined by (WHO 2022) or International Consensus Classification (2022) * Diffuse large B-cell lymphoma (DLBCL) * Transformations of indolent B-cell lymphomas (excluding Richter's transformation) * DLBCL/High-grade B-cell lymphoma (HGBCL) with MYC and BCL2 rearrangements * High-grade B-cell lymphoma (HGBCL) not otherwise specified (HGBCL NOS) * Primary mediastinal large B-cell lymphoma (PMBCL) * Grade 3B follicular lymphoma/large cell follicular lymphoma (FL3B) 3. Relapsed or refractory disease after anti-CD20 antibody and anthracycline-containing first-line chemoimmunotherapy 4. Measurable disease by presence of \[18F\]-fluorodeoxyglucose PET/CT positive lesion during Screening per Lugano Criteria 5. Eastern Cooperative Oncology Group (ECOG) performance status 0 or 1 6. Adequate hematological, renal, hepatic, pulmonary, and cardiac function Key Exclusion Criteria: 1. Patients ineligible to receive CD19 CAR T-cell therapy 2. Primary CNS lymphoma 3. Patients with primary cutaneous LBCL, human herpes virus-8 positive lymphoma, Burkitt lymphoma, T cell histiocyte-rich lymphoma, or transformation from chronic lymphocytic leukemia/small lymphocytic lymphoma (Richter's transformation) 4. Patients with prior history of malignancy, other than aggressive relapsed or refractory LBCL, unless the patient has been free of the disease for ≥ 2 years 5. Patients with uncontrolled systemic fungal, bacterial, viral, or other infection (including tuberculosis) despite appropriate antibiotics or other treatment 6. Active autoimmune disease requiring ongoing systemic immunosuppressive therapy. Note: Other protocol defined Inclusion/Exclusion criteria may apply
